Key Responsibilities

  • •Oversee all county HR functions, ensuring compliance with HR requirements and applicable employment laws.
  • •Manage recruitment and hiring processes, including interviews, background checks, pre-employment drug testing, eligibility verifications, and new employee orientation coordination.
  • •Administer benefits and wage programs, maintain HRIS and personnel files, and prepare annual salary/benefit estimates for the Board of Commissioners.
  • •Lead employee relations and offboarding: advise employees on benefits and inquiries, oversee performance evaluations, investigate grievances, support disciplinary meetings and terminations, and manage retention programs.
  • •Develop and oversee safety/injury prevention and workers’ compensation compliance, review accident/hazard reports, and conduct labor negotiations; supervise an administrative assistant.

Key Requirements

  • •Bachelor’s degree in Human Resources, Business Administration, or related field plus at least 8 years of Human Resource Management experience, or an equivalent combination of education and experience.
  • •Strong knowledge of personnel management principles and practices, with ability to analyze and resolve HR issues.
  • •Experience managing recruitment and hiring, including background checks, pre-employment drug testing, and eligibility verifications.
  • •Ability to conduct employee relations work including performance evaluations, grievance investigations, and participation/advice in disciplinary meetings and terminations.
  • •Proficiency with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, Outlook) and County HR software/HRIS systems; HRCI or SHRM certification desired.
